Output 89bb7cfc0b6c38c7de6c7fe67b2a9ca285339f47dcd20b5ce70b9e938e1ff28c:0

value
44900
script pubkey
OP_0 OP_PUSHBYTES_20 d51460ee0e33aa13535680ee76a66aecd6fc2c40
address
bc1q652xpmswxw4px56ksrh8dfn2ant0ctzqzuy4lt
transaction
89bb7cfc0b6c38c7de6c7fe67b2a9ca285339f47dcd20b5ce70b9e938e1ff28c
confirmations
128627
spent
true